Set entirely in Churchill's private bunker, this one-man show stars Edmund L. Shaff, who has a remarkable resemblance to the British leader. The play takes place on April 4, 1955, the night Churchill decided to resign as Prime Minister. In reaching this historic decision, he reflects on his political journey and his strained relationship with his father. Portrait also shares Churchill's fears that his successor might lack the strength to stand up to the Soviets, his admiration and respect for FCR, General Patton, Harry S. Truman, his abiding love for his parents, and his shocking, unexpected electoral defeat in 1945.
